J J Harris passed this result sheet to Jocky at the Vets dinner on Friday:
http://www.royal-albertcc.com/storage/ecosse%2062%20race%20results%2019630002.jpg
Jocky Johnstone, fresh from beasting up the Clyde Valley climbs, raids the East Coast and gets 5th place in this 24.5 mile race, narrowly beating his club-mate of a mere 48 years later, Dennis White, by four minutes! Well, I was MUCH younger than Jocky!
Other names on the list that come to mind are, J J Harris, also famous for organising the Trossachs TT for many years, John McMillan, Scottish 100 mile record holder and still races in London today, Tosh McIntosh, a great junior at the time, Jock Ritchie, another well known time trialist of the time, Barry Carnegie, a strong roadman from Dundee, Brian Temple, silver medallist in the 1970 Commonwealth Games in Edinburgh, Irvine Morrison, later became Scottish Junior RR Champion, Scottish Championship 50 mile record holder, Roy Francey, a good roadman at the time, Alan Richardson, a good roadman and sprinter (I'm sure Sandy Bain could tell you about scraps with some of these guys).
Class act from oor Jocky!
Two years later, Irvine Morrison and I beat Brian Temple and Roy Francy in a 25 miles 2-up by over a minute. I almost caught John McMillan off a minute in the 1963 Scottish Hillclimb Championship race at Glentarkie in Fife. Later on, John would be dropped on steep hills in club runs in January/February, then come out in June and get Scottish TT records!
